Make sure you are in Bergen at the end of May for the yearly International Festival. The Bergen International Festival presents art in all its guises: music, literature, theatre, dance, opera and visual art. The Bergen International Festival is the largest of its kind in the Nordic countries, with more than 150 events in 15 days.  

Every summer in the month of June you can take a trip with the school ship "Statsraad Lehmkhul" from Bergen to the archipelago. This is a pleasant sailtrip on this ship from 1914.

A walk through the narrow passages on "Bryggen" in Bergen feels like travelling back in time. "Bryggen" is not a museum, but a cultural heritage that's in use, a living historical district with 61 protected buildings. Today this is a bustling area with shops, art studios, restaurants and offices.

Travelling with children? Take them to the Aquarium in Bergen and experience everything from cod to crocodilles and even sharks! The aquarium has over 60 different species, so there's something for everyone here. In the summer there are also concerts and shows.
